Newcastle host Liverpool on Monday night in what many expect to be a heated encounter, and we’re providing the latest team news and predicted lineups ahead of the action.

Defending Premier League champions Liverpool left it late to beat Bournemouth on the opening weekend.

Having taken a 2-0 lead early in the second half, they conceded twice to allow the visitors to draw level.

But further goals from Federico Chiesa and Mohamed Salah ensured Arne Slot’s side took all three points.

Newcastle, meanwhile, were held to a goalless draw against Aston Villa.

Newcastle Team News

The most glaring omission for Newcastle will be that of Liverpool transfer target Alexander Isak.

Swedish striker Isak has made clear his desire to move to Anfield.

But after a bid worth £110 million was rejected, Isak has been training away from the wider squad and is confirmed not to be involved on Monday.

Newcastle fans have applauded the club’s stance on Isak, supporting the Magpies’ hardline approach to the debacle.

In better news, Newcastle have completed the signing of Jacob Ramsey from Aston Villa.

There are also no fresh injury concerns for Eddie Howe, and Joe Willock has returned to training.

Although unlikely to start, he should be fit enough for the bench at least.

Liverpool Team News

As for Liverpool, they do have a few unavailabilities to contend with.

New arrival Jeremie Frimpong went off with a hamstring tweak last weekend.

The Dutch fullback is confirmed to be missing for this one.

However, both Conor Bradley and Joe Gomez are back in training, and could slot in.

But with Limited minutes, Arne Slot has acknowledged it would be asking a lot, meaning he may prefer to play Waturo Endo out of position at fullback.

Regarding the right-back dilemma, he said:  “So, there are other options we can explore.

“Joe Gomez is definitely one of them, but for him to play already 20 minutes, that was already quite a lot.

“I wouldn’t say he had a setback but he wasn’t able to train three days in a row completely with the team.

“Which is completely normal if you’re out for so long and all of a sudden the manager needs you for 20 minutes.”

“But he is training with the team, so let’s see where he is on Monday, if he can be involved in the team or if he can even start.”
